Einzelnen Beitrag anzeigen

DevilsCamp
(Gast)

n/a Beiträge
 
#1

Wie Klasse des Besitzers herausfinden und benutzen?

  Alt 28. Aug 2005, 07:44
Ich habe eine Komponente, abgeleitet von TGraphicControl.
Deren Owner muss ja auch nicht unbedingt ein TForm sein, sondern kann auf ein TPanel, TGroupBox o.ä. sein.

über z.B.
Edit1.ClassType.ClassName Bekomme ich zwar die Klasse als String, aber wie kann ich das nun weiterverarbeiten?
Ich meine, dass ich z.B. folgenden Code ausführen kann:
Delphi-Quellcode:
procedure TMeineKomponente.SetInfo;
begin
  Self.InfoText := 'Mein Besitzer hat folgenden Titel: '+(Owner as OWNER_KLASSE).Caption;
end;
  Mit Zitat antworten Zitat